Symbol and Dingbat hackery

From: Tomas Frydrych <tf_at_o-hand.com>
Date: Mon Mar 20 2006 - 18:18:05 CET

I think we should take the oportunity in the 2.6 cycle to get rid of the
Symbol and Dingbat hackery that plagues our graphics classes. My
suggestion is that:

* We increase the AW document version to 1.2 and start storing all
character values in Unicode.

* We add code somewhere (where ever it makes most sense, probably
PD_Document), to translate Symbol and Dingbat codes to Unicode on import
of AW doc version < 1.2.

* There might need to be some changes to the win32 base class should we
continue to support Win9x in 2.6, although I think Uniscribe deals with
this internally, not entire sure.

* There might need to be some changes to our importers and exporters,
have not investigated that yet, but with possible exception of rtf/doc,
this should amount to removal of hacks.

I have got the Unix side nearly ready, just need to deal with the AW
legacy issue.

Tomas
Received on Mon Mar 20 18:18:09 2006

This archive was generated by hypermail 2.1.8 : Mon Mar 20 2006 - 18:18:10 CET